Hull Identification Number: The Hull Identification Number (HIN) is located on the starboard side of the transom. Be sure to record the HIN in the space provided above and always refer to the HIN for all correspondence or orders. 2 CHAPTER 1: WELCOME ABOARD! Engines & Accessories Guidelines Your boat’s engines and accessories were selected to provide optimum performance and service. Installing different engines or accessories may cause unwanted handling characteristics. Should you choose to install different engines or add accessories that will affect the boat’s running trim, have an experienced marine technician perform a safety inspection and handling test before operating your boat again.
CHAPTER 1: WELCOME ABOARD! 3 Special Care For Moored Boats If moored in saltwater or fresh water, your boat will collect marine growth on its hull bottom. This will detract from the boat’s beauty, greatly affect its performance and may damage the gelcoat. There are two methods of slowing marine growth: • Periodically haul the boat out of the water and scrub the hull bottom with a bristle brush and a solution of soap and water. • Paint the hull below the waterline with a good grade of anti-fouling paint.
4 CHAPTER 2: PRODUCT SPECIFICATIONS 2109 Length overall - 21' 3" Beam - 8' 3" Deadrise - 16 degrees Weight (standard engine) - 3,1458 lb. Draft hull - 1' 3" Draft max - 2' 8" Bridge clearance - 4' 2" Fuel capacity - 45 gal. Freshwater capacity (option) - 19 gal. 2159 Length overall - 21' 3" Beam - 8' 3" Deadrise - 16 degrees Weight - 3,750 lb. Draft hull - 1' 4" Draft max - 2' 8" Bridge clearance - 4' 1" Fuel capacity - 45 gal. Freshwater capacity (option) - 19 gal.

6 CHAPTER 3: COMPONENTS / SYSTEMS DC Electrical System All Rendezvous models are equipped with a 12 volt DC (direct current) system. Fuses and Circuit Breakers • Fuses and circuit breakers for engines and main accessory power are located on the dash. • Electronics power is provided at the helm. • Some equipment may have secondary fuse protection at the unit. Battery Maintenance Corroded battery terminals can be cleaned with baking soda and water.

8 CHAPTER 3: COMPONENTS / SYSTEMS Bilge Systems Bilge Pumps • Your boat is equipped with impeller-type bilge pumps, which are used to pump water out of the bilge. • Bilge pumps are controlled by automatic bilge pump float switches (autofloat switches) and/or switches at the helm. • Automatic bilge pumps are wired directly to the battery so they will function even when the boat is completely shut down and left unattended.
CHAPTER 3: COMPONENTS / SYSTEMS 9 Autofloat switches should be tested often for proper operation as follows: 1. 2. Push the float switch test button UP to activate the bilge pump. If the pump does NOT turn on, check the inline fuse. If the fuse is good but the switch doesn’t work, it may indicate a bad switch or possibly a low battery. Push the test button all the way DOWN to return the float switch back into the auto mode.

CHAPTER 3: COMPONENTS / SYSTEMS 11 Live Well System (Option) Your boat may come equipped with an optional live well (not available on all boats), which may be used to hold live fish or bait. • The aerator pump installed in the live well system is used to pump a continuous supply of oxygenated raw water into the live well. The switch for the aerator pump can be found at the dash. Occasionally check the aerator pump when it is operating to verify that it is pumping adequate amounts of water.
12 CHAPTER 3: COMPONENTS / SYSTEMS Pedestal Seat PEDESTAL SEAT If your boat features a removable pedestal seat, remove the seat and stow it in a safe and secure area while underway or when trailering your boat. ! DAN GEDANGER R! PERSONAL INJURY HAZARD! NEVER occupy the pedestal seat while your boat is underway. Sitting on the pedestal seat while the boat is underway is especially hazardous and WILL cause personal injury or death.

36 APPENDIX A: LIMITED WARRANTY Bayliner warrants to the original purchasers of its Rendezvous model boats, purchased from an authorized dealer, operated under normal, noncommercial use that the selling dealer will: (A) Repair any structural hull defect which occurs within five (5) years of the date of delivery; and (B) Repair or replace any parts found to be defective in factory material or workmanship within one (1) year of the date of delivery.
